It's really easy, just configure another vhost in Apache. Use a
different hostname for each vhost and it will just work.
You can then go to http://app1/ or http://app2/ in your browser (/etc/
hosts mangling on your local machine might be required).

k:
MAILTO=your address
above the jobs you want to receive the output from. Also, if you're
running anything intense/regularly you should really use something
like lockrun (http://unixwiz.net/tools/lockrun.html) to prevent
overrun, swapping and untimely server death.
